Understanding Highway Tires For Trucks

Highway tires for trucks are specially designed to provide optimal performance and durability for trucks primarily used on highways and paved roads. These tires are engineered to offer a smooth and quiet ride while ensuring stability and control at high speeds. They are a popular choice for commercial trucks, long-haul drivers, and everyday commuters who predominantly drive on paved surfaces.

One key feature of highway tires is their tread pattern, which is designed to provide superior traction on dry, wet, and even light snowy road conditions. The tread is typically shallower and less aggressive compared to off-road or all-terrain tires, allowing for better fuel efficiency and longer tread life on smooth surfaces. This makes highway tires a practical choice for drivers seeking a balance between performance, comfort, and longevity.

Moreover, highway tires are constructed with durable materials and reinforced sidewalls to withstand the demands of heavy loads and extended highway use. This helps in improving overall handling, stability, and braking performance, especially during sudden stops or emergency maneuvers. With their focus on road-specific performance and longevity, highway tires are a reliable option for those who prioritize comfort and safety for their trucking needs. Overall, highway tires offer a compelling combination of performance, durability, and comfort for trucks that primarily operate on highways and paved roads.

Tire Maintenance Tips For Longevity

Proper tire maintenance is essential for ensuring longevity and optimal performance of your highway truck tires. Regularly check the tire pressure to ensure they are inflated to the manufacturer’s recommended levels. Incorrect tire pressure can lead to uneven wear and reduced fuel efficiency. Inspect the tires for any signs of damage, such as cuts, bulges, or punctures, and promptly address any issues to prevent further damage.

Rotation of tires is crucial to promote even wear across all tires. Regularly rotating your tires can extend their lifespan and improve overall performance. Additionally, balancing your tires helps to prevent uneven wear and vibration, leading to a smoother and safer driving experience.

Maintaining proper alignment is key to maximizing the lifespan of your highway tires. Misaligned tires can cause uneven wear and negatively impact handling and fuel efficiency. Regularly check the alignment and adjust as needed to ensure your tires wear evenly and last longer.

Lastly, keep your tires clean by regularly washing them with soap and water to remove dirt, debris, and brake dust. Clean tires not only look better but also help prevent premature wear and deterioration. By following these tire maintenance tips, you can prolong the life of your highway truck tires and ensure a safer and more efficient driving experience.

Comparing All-Season Vs. Highway Tires

When deciding between all-season tires and highway tires for your truck, it’s important to consider the specific needs of your driving. All-season tires are designed to provide good performance in a variety of conditions, including light snow and rain. They have a versatile tread pattern that offers decent traction on different road surfaces. On the other hand, highway tires are best suited for long stretches of smooth, dry roads. They prioritize fuel efficiency, quiet operation, and a comfortable ride.

All-season tires typically have deeper treads and more siping to handle a range of weather conditions, making them a popular choice for drivers who want convenience and versatility. Highway tires, with their shallower treads and sturdier construction, excel in providing stability and handling at higher speeds, ideal for long highway drives. If you primarily drive on well-maintained roads and prioritize fuel efficiency, highway tires may be the better choice.

In summary, when comparing all-season tires to highway tires for trucks, consider your driving habits, the road conditions you commonly encounter, and your priorities regarding performance characteristics. Both tire types have their strengths, so choose the one that best fits your driving needs and environment.

How Do Highway Tires Differ From Off-Road Tires For Trucks?

Highway tires for trucks are designed for smooth, quiet rides on paved roads, offering superior handling and traction. They have shallower tread patterns for better fuel efficiency and less road noise. On the other hand, off-road tires are built for rugged terrains, with deep grooves and aggressive tread patterns for maximum traction and durability. They provide better grip on gravel, mud, and rocks, but can be noisier and less efficient on regular road surfaces. Ultimately, the choice between highway and off-road tires depends on the driver’s intended use and terrain conditions.
